Default 94 Blazer wont hold oil pressure

I just finished rebuilding my 4.3 for the second time this year and the same thing continues to happen. It will only maintain proper oil pressure when its cold or higher rpms. I have completely overhualed the engine myself. Please help. I put a mechanical oil pressure gauge on it to verify the pressure. I'm about to pull the front axel and gear box to remove oil pan so I can figure this out. If anyone has any ideas please let me know.

1. On your rebuild, did you put a new oil pump in or take it apart and clean it to make sure everything is good to go?

2. Maybe there is a problem within the remote adapters, the oil cooler lines or the oil filter bypass valve?

My oil pressure when the truck is cold sits at about 50. When the engine is hot it drops to almost nothing, about 2 to 5 psi. I had purchased a new oil pump for the truck when it was rebuilt. I made sure it was working right and cleaned out. I did some research and found out that vehicles with a remote oil filter system, such as what I have on my engine, it is recommended to run a high volume oil pump otherwise you can lose up to 25% of your oil pressure.
